Not all coins provided by Apex Crypto LLC are available to New York residents.Webull’s US-regulated branch is a member of SIPC, the US investor protection scheme. If you are a client of Webull’s US-regulated entity, you will be entitled to SIPC investor protection regardless of your citizenship or residency. Webull Financial LLC’s clearing firm Apex Clearing Corp has purchased an additional insurance policy. Brokerage firms, including Webull, are not FDIC insured because they are not banks and do not offer bank accounts. Instead, brokerage accounts are covered by the Securities Investor Protection Corporation (SIPC), which plays a similar role in protecting investors’ assets.The FDIC deposit insurance covers losses to a limit for each depositor and for each account ownership category. Limits are as follows: Single accounts: Up to $250,000 per depositor, per bank ...
